bradley - tough but winnable fight for JMM. bradley doesn't have the power to hurt JMM, but JMm will have to worry about bradley's speed, volume punching and his mobility as JMM isn't getting any younger or faster. If he wants to, he could brawl with bradley, but it's not advised as bradley should have better handspeed. there's no way bradley should be able to outbox JMM.
alexander - another tough but winnable fight for JMM. alexander has the power to hurt JMM, he's faster, and more mobile, but he throws a lot of unnecessary punches that JMM might be able to counter. JMM needs to be patient and wait for countering opportunities.
khan - very tough fight, but JMM has a puncher's chance. He shouldn't fight Khan. khan's height, reach, and speed of hand and feet, and that jab will be very difficult for jmm to get past. plus roach knows jmm and will have the perfect gameplan. of course khan is chinny, so jmm might get the KO with enough persistence and if he takes 2 punches to land 1.
maidana - easiest fight at 140 lbs for JMM. JMM easily outboxes maidana. he better not brawl w/ maidana tho. he might get KOed.
